General Information about #0A1ADC
The hexadecimal color #0A1ADC, also known as Dark Blue, is a deep shade of blue with a significant presence of blue pigment, accompanied by small traces of red. It falls within the blue color family and is often associated with feelings of trust, authority, and stability. In color psychology, dark blue is frequently used to represent knowledge, power, integrity, and seriousness. This color is often used in corporate branding and website design to create a sense of security and professionalism. The color #0A1ADC, a deep, dark blue, presents some accessibility challenges, particularly concerning color contrast. When using this color for text, it's crucial to ensure sufficient contrast against the background to meet WCAG (Web Content Accessibility Guidelines) standards. A light background is recommended to provide adequate contrast for readability. Tools like contrast checkers can be utilized to verify compliance. Furthermore, avoid using color as the sole means of conveying important information, as users with color vision deficiencies might miss it. Supplement color cues with text or icons. For interactive elements like buttons, ensure they have clear focus states visible to keyboard users. Consider the needs of users with various visual impairments and cognitive differences when designing with this dark blue. Adhering to accessibility best practices ensures that the content is usable by a wider audience.

Web Design
In web design, #0A1ADC can be used to create a sophisticated and trustworthy feel. It's ideal for websites related to finance, technology, or education. The dark blue can be applied to header backgrounds, navigation menus, or as an accent color for buttons and links. When combined with lighter shades of blue or complementary colors like yellow, it can create a visually appealing and engaging user experience. Remember to maintain sufficient contrast for readability and accessibility.
